## Deploying the Gatewick Proctor Queue

Deploys are pretty painless: push to main, wait for the pipeline, then watch the queue drain dashboard for five minutes. If candidates pile up mid-exam, roll back first and ask questions later — the queue replays safely. Everything the workers care about lives in one config block, shown here for reference.

settings of bafof-yagef:
JOROX_PIN=8740
JOROX_TENANT=pelox
JOROX_METRICS_HOST=metrics.jorox.qorvelworks.internal
JOROX_SEAL=seal_c78f63c1
JOROX_STANDBY_TEAM=norax

- [ ] Step 7: Archive cold storage buckets (Glacierline tier). Confirm both ceremony witnesses are present, verify bucket manifests match the Oxbow ledger, then seal the archive key shares. Plugin authors may observe but not handle shares. Once sealed, the archive index itself is encrypted and can only be reopened with the passphrase below.

vault phrase of badup-hahig = tamael-aldael-kelmir-istael-fenok-istwyn-tamius-jorath-oliion

Subject: Handover – Timetabler DB

Hi Verla,

Welcome aboard. Before I rotate off, a few notes on the Klassweave timetable solver. The scheduler writes candidate timetables to the staging schema nightly, and the constraint tables are read-only during term. Please verify replication lag before any maintenance. You'll connect to the primary instance using the string below.

replica DSN, kajep-yahag: mssql://praok_svc:iF@db-8d68.plorvaio.local:5432/eliion

Excerpt from the Copperline gateway design, for this week's sync. Nodes behind the balancer expose a deep health endpoint that exercises the datastore and cache, not just process liveness. The balancer ejects a node after consecutive failures and readmits it after a cool-down probe succeeds, which avoids flapping during deploys. Timings were chosen from load-test runs on the Ashgrove cluster. The proposed constants are as follows.

tuning table, kajog-bawip:
TIERS = {
    "kelius": 256,
    "lammir": 543,
}